Marshall vs. Virginia Tech: Live updates, score, results, highlights, for Saturday's NCAA Football game
Live scores, highlights and updates from the Marshall vs. Virginia Tech football game
The Marshall Thundering Herd will be playing at home against the Virginia Tech Hokies at 12:00 p.m. ET on Saturday at Joan C. Edwards Stadium. Marshall will be looking to extend their current 7-game winning streak.
Last Saturday, Marshall's game was all tied up 10-10 at the half, but luckily for them it didn't stay that way. They strolled past East Carolina with points to spare, taking the game 31-13. With that win, Marshall brought their scoring average up to 26 points per game.
Marshall can attribute much of their success to RB Rasheen Ali, who rushed for 85 yards and three touchdowns. Ali was no stranger to the big play, turning on the jets for a run that went for 56 yards. WR Caleb McMillan loomed large in the win by picking up 85 receiving yards and a touchdown.
Meanwhile, Virginia Tech traveled a rocky road last season, and unfortunately for them the road doesn't seem to have gotten any smoother. They took a 35-16 bruising from Rutgers on Saturday.
Nobody from Virginia Tech had a standout game, but they still got scores from QB Kyron Drones and RB Bhayshul Tuten.
Looking ahead, Marshall are the favorite in this one, as the experts expect to see them win by five points. They finished last season with an even 6-6 record against the spread.
Marshall ought to be happy about their advantage in the spread: the team was a solid 5-4 when favored last season. Thundering Herd fans who chose to bet on their team sure did well last year: betting $100 on them to win every matchup netted those bettors $1,833.01. On the other hand, Virginia Tech were 1-6 as the underdog last season.
